The Star. WEDNESDAY, JULY 20, 1870.
. ME TEAVEES AND THE "LYTTELTON TIMES." About a fortnight ago an article appeared in the Lyttelton Times, criticising the speeches of some of the Canterbury members upon the Financial Statement. Among others, Mr Travers came in for his share. Though the writer waa perfectly fair in what he said, and the criticism was temperate enough, Mr Travers made it a pretence for getting up a mighty show of anger. An address to the electors of Christ-' church, resigning his seat, was the* consequence. We reprint both the address and reply, which will probably amuse our readers.
